Grant Name:

Understanding the Mechanisms Driving the Melting of Thwaites Glacier

  • Date Awarded:
    Jun 2025
     
  • Amount:
    $1,999,985
     
  • Term:
    48 months
     
  • Grant ID:
    GBMF13524
     
  • Funding Area:
    Science
     
 
 

To support field studies at Thwaites Glacier, Antarctica, aimed at investigating the physical mechanisms at the grounding zone that are contributing to the glacier’s accelerated melting.
